Temperament

Macaws are amongst the largest birds in the true parrot (Psittacidae) family and provide a mix of beauty, intelligence and curiosity that has attracted human attention for many centuries. The scarlet, military, and Lolita blue & gold macaw and gold macaws are among the species available in the pet market. Hahn's, illiger's and other smaller macaws are also found.

Macaws are wonderful companions, they need an immense amount of time and energy to keep them content. These birds are social and thrive when they interact with their owners. It is essential to select an individual who has experience breeding and training macaws. Before buying a macaw, inquire about its health, diet, and training history.

A healthy macaw requires a well-rounded diet that includes a wide variety of foods. They also require plenty of space to exercise and spread their wings. Macaws, unlike other species of birds can't live in cages too small.

They can be destructive in the incorrect hands and will require plenty of toys and enrichment items to keep them entertained. They might require a cage made of a durable material and placed in a space that is stable temperature. The cage should be stocked with toys, perches and other things that stimulate the mind.

These intelligent birds can be trained to master tricks and even mimic speech. They may not be able speak as clearly as Amazon or African grey parrots but they can be taught to consistently speak words. A macaw can only be taught by an expert trainer. This will keep it from becoming dangerous.

In the wild, macaws eat many seeds as well as nuts, plants and fruits. It is recommended to feed them a high quality pelleted food specially formulated specifically for macaws. A mix of vegetables, fruits, and seeds should also be provided. Dietary supplements should not contain salt, harlequin Macaw sugar or fat.

If properly taken care of Macaws can last until 50 years old. A poor diet, hormonal imbalances and drastic environmental changes can reduce the life span of macaws.

Macaws are intelligent, affectionate birds that create strong bonds with humans. They can talk, solve puzzles and imitate human speech if trained properly. They are sensitive and must be socialized from an early age in order to feel secure and secure with their human family. They are very active birds and require a huge cage that allows them to exercise. They can live up to 50 years, so the family needs to be committed to caring for them throughout their lives.

As they grow older, macaws can become less affectionate to their owners. This is due to their high levels of hormones and is a natural process similar to the human teenage experience through. It can be a bit frustrating for first-time parrot owners but is normal. Once the hormones settle and the parrots begin to bond with their owners and will become more affectionate.

A macaw's diet is quite varied however it should consist of a healthy balance of vegetables, fruits and seeds. It is important to provide these birds with clean, fresh water daily. It is also beneficial to offer them a variety of branches to chew and perch on. The branches you offer should be made of wood that is safe for your bird.

The macaw has innate curiosity and is a lover of the world around it. It is a good idea to place its cage in an area where it can see a lot of activity, but avoid placing the cage in front of windows during the day because they are too hot for your bird. It is also an excellent idea to position the cage out of the drafts produced by heating and cooling systems.
